Salve gente, e' da ieri sera che mi scervello per capire quale sia il problema.
Io ho diversi form dove invio dei dati attraverso il metodo GET, del tipo:
FORM1:
Codice HTML:<form method="GET" name="form1"> <span>Scegli1:</span> <select name="scegli1"> <option value=""></option> <option value="a">a</option> <option value="b">b</option> </select> <input type="submit" name="conferma1" value="Conferma" /> </form>Il problema è che arrivato al secondo form e premuto il tasto Conferma perdo i dati precedenti, in questo caso perdo $_GET['scegli1'].Codice PHP:if(isset($_GET['conferma1']) && $_GET['scegli1']!=""){
header("Location: ?form=1&scegli1=".$_GET['scegli1']."");
}
Avevo quindi pensato a passarlo in una variabile del tipo:
Solo che fino a prima di premere il tasto Conferma del secondo form il valore è corretto ma appena lo premo si annulla pure qui.Codice PHP:$scelta_form1=$_GET['scegli1'];
Sapete aiutarmi?
Grazie![]()

LinkBack URL
About LinkBacks

